Manager/Senior Manager, West and North Africa
Location: Dakar, Senegal

About IDinsight
We amplify social impact by partnering with leaders to develop tailored solutions. Our mission is to improve lives with data and evidence. We transform how the world fights poverty.

IDinsight is a global nonprofit that equips leaders with the data, evidence and technology to improve lives at scale. We partner with governments, NGOs, multilaterals, and funders to support decisions at every stage of their impact journey – from bold pilots to nationwide scale-ups. Our teams bring rigorous evidence and practical insights so leaders can make informed decisions that truly change lives. With our partners, we are pioneering the next frontier of social impact, where data and technology accelerate progress for millions. We help leaders overcome the three main barriers to impact:
* Figuring out what works
* Learning and improving
* Reaching and operating at scale

We work in multiple countries across Asia and Africa. Our work spans a wide range of sectors, including agriculture, education, health, governance, sanitation, financial inclusion, and other areas.
We have expertise in a variety of rigorous approaches and methodologies, which we tailor to each client depending on their needs and constraints. To achieve a positive social impact we:
* Support our partners with the full 'data and evidence' value chain – from primary data collection to data systems, monitoring evaluation and learning tools, and data science
* Inform funding decisions – toward high-impact initiatives and away from less effective programs or approaches
* Create cutting-edge AI-for-good products that make the delivery of social interventions and learning tools more cost-effective and scalable

Our diverse, growing team of roughly 250 outstanding colleagues operate in nearly two dozen countries around the world. Learn more about our mission, values, and principles at www.IDinsight.org (http://www.idinsight.org).

About the Manager / Senior Manager role
Managers are dynamic, diverse leaders who are passionate about making a difference, possess exceptional analytical skills and thrive in an entrepreneurial setting. IDinsight invests heavily in our employees' professional development and expects them to think critically and creatively about how to maximize our clients' social impact.

Managers oversee all aspects of client engagements (with support from an IDinsight Director) in order to produce high-quality outputs, but more importantly, to drive each client to maximize its social impact. Towards this end, Managers are expected to develop a diverse skill set, including establishing trusted advisor relationships with clients, mentoring high-performing early professionals (Associates), developing expertise in a broad range of data and evidence tools and overseeing all project and/or office-related safety & security risk management for their team members.

Key Responsibilities:
Client relationships:
* Managers establish themselves as experts and trusted advisors to IDinsight clients.
* Managers use this position to provide high-quality counsel and support based on rigorous evidence for senior leaders in governments, foundations, NGOs, and socially impactful businesses.
Project management, technical & communication skills:
* Managers lead all elements of IDinsight advisory and evaluation projects, including project management, oversight of analytical processes, engagement of internal and external experts, evaluation design and development of high-quality materials including policy briefs, technical reports, and presentation materials.
* As part of project management, managers are expected to support and improve existing administrative systems to ensure project administration tasks such as staffing requests, timesheet submission and approvals, staff leave management, change management etc. are executed properly.
* Managers need not be experts in specific analytical tools and methods, but must be able to develop a deep and nuanced understanding of how data and evidence tools can be used to help answer the clients' questions. Managers are also responsible for cross-functional collaboration with the technical teams at IDinsight, to maintain rigour of the work.
Mentorship of junior staff:
* Manage timelines, quality control, and risk mitigation within the context of project constraints to ensure effective project execution.
* Responsible for providing mentorship and guidance to all team members, especially Associates, and fostering a collaborative and high-performance environment.
* Lead project budget design and management, and all funder compliances for the project.
Financial management:
* Managers lead project budget design and management, and are responsible for identifying any financial risks to different stakeholders as early as possible.
* Managers lead all funder compliances for the project, and support the Director in managing funder relationships.
IDinsight growth:
* As required, Managers are encouraged to contribute to IDinsight's organizational development by helping to improve and refine the IDinsight approach, develop new client engagements, establish and improve internal processes and culture, and potentially help open new IDinsight offices or start new services.

Qualifications
* Deep passion for improving lives around the world
* Demonstrated interest in the use of evidence, rigorous impact measurement, and data to improve development policies and programs
* Advanced degree, preferably in public policy, economics, public administration, business
* 4-8 years of relevant work experience, including managerial experience in similar settings as IDinsight
* Outstanding interpersonal, leadership, and communication skills with senior decision-makers
* Proven ability to lead and motivate other staff in a dynamic and diverse environment
* Outstanding critical thinking skills, with a nuanced understanding of data and evidence tools, including but not limited to statistical software
* Self-starter who will thrive in a start-up setting by taking ownership and initiative
* Fluency in French and English (spoken and written) is required
* Intellectual curiosity and sense of humour

Candidates will be evaluated for a Manager vs. Senior Manager role based on their qualifications, previous experiences, and performance during the hiring processes.
